Today, I wore my new arrival on my left wrist: Charmex Swiss Military Watch 20000 Feet. It's like an Abrams A1 M1 tank on the wrist. All titanium, 46mm across and 25mm tall (about 1 inch) with 24mm lugs. The AR-coated sapphire crystal itself is 10mm thick and starts from the top of the dome-shaped crystal to the bottom of the bezel where the crystal rests on the case. Of course, it's a diver with chronograph and HEV plus best of all, it's COSC-certified. Dial is black carbon fiber and sort of emits a 3D effect because of the crystal's thickness and its shape. The behemoth is so hard to photograph because it's possessed by the demon of reflections who lives inside the crystal. The water reistance is built for 7,500 feet but was rated at 6,000 feet giving a good 25% margin of safety (as if I'd even dive deeper than 30 feetsubtlelaugh.gif). It's on the Guiness Book of World records. Despite the size (like a double patty burger), it's not heavy at all. Thanks to titanium all throughout. Each link is screwed. Lume is amazing! It's like looking at the constellations of the night sky and this is because of all the lume applied on all important and crucial points of this diver. A longer review will follow. Hope you like it.
